Transaction 2d50dd11e28a2b2315b8ef0585f8ee5ae4658d7e70ef7ffee9c54879af110e02
2 Input
1 Outputs
- 2d50dd11e28a2b2315b8ef0585f8ee5ae4658d7e70ef7ffee9c54879af110e02:0
value 11677016
address 3Q356Poh7ffS4MXvamnHoKHwQCTSJW2bR9